Title: Management of obesity disease in primary care setting: Six months outcome of a family physician interested in weight loss treatment

Abstract

Background- As family physicians deal on a daily basis with obesity and all its comorbidities, it was important to introduce new modalities and try to achieve better results. Methods- We present the material and tools utilized in a primary care clinic (Indiana, USA) after physician to start (March 2014) a wt loss program in conjunction with routine care. Obese patients were asked to join program then given an Obesity History Form (1); with assessment of patients' motivation and readiness to change. Then a brief introduction to low GI carb and high protein diet and baseline lab panel obtained. At the second visit the metabolic profile was reviewed, and two other steps were performed: first, brief counseling lifestyle (done by the physician). Second, was a modified Eating Behavior Questionnaire (EBQ) (2), then introduction of prescribed Rx. Patient was then seen in two weeks to monitor drug and diet changes (repeat EBQ), and plans reviewed. Then every month afterwards (6 months) with focus on patients’ specific comorbidities behavioral and medical. Results- Details to follow. Note: so far, at least 82 obese patients (av. age 44, av. BMI 37.8) completed the wt loss program. Then data is analyzed as %wt loss and CV risk profile improvement. Conclusion- Family physicians can do a great job in treating obesity.
